The Kingwood Mustangs are taking a road trip to take on the Stratford Spartans at 6:00 p.m. on Saturday. Both might be coming in a bit winded given how much these teams ran up and down the field in their prior games.
Last Thursday, Kingwood was able to grind out a solid victory over La Porte, taking the game 28-21. The win made it back-to-back victories for the Mustangs.
Marquez Xavion Ziair Davis had an outrageously good game as he rushed for 170 yards and two touchdowns while picking up 8.1 yards per carry. His rushing production has been exceptional recently as that marked his fifth straight game with at least 101 rushing yards dating back to last season. Holland Hargrave was another key player, throwing for 185 yards and a touchdown on only 13 passes.
Kingwood was moving up and down the field and finished the game with 410 total yards. That's the most total yards they've posted since was before the start of last season.
Meanwhile, Stratford humbled Oak Ridge with a 66-28 victory. Given the Spartans' advantage in MaxPreps' Texas football rankings (they are ranked 146th, while the War Eagles are ranked 372nd), the result on Thursday wasn't entirely unexpected.
Aaron Deleon was nothing short of spectacular: he threw for 327 yards and six touchdowns while completing 71.4% of his passes, and also rushed for 52 yards and a touchdown on only seven carries. With that strong performance, he is now averaging an impressive 4 passing touchdowns per game. Another player making a difference was Hunter Biehl, who picked up 214 receiving yards and four touchdowns.
Stratford wouldn't let Oak Ridge keep a hold of the ball as they managed to force two fumbles. Stratford can thank Rayden Barnes and Tiergan Burl for forcing both of them. Stratford got some further help from Parker Johnson: he made 15 total tackles (1.5 for loss) and defended a pass in addition to snagging an interception.
Kingwood's record is now 2-0. As for Stratford, the win also got them back to even at 1-1.
Kingwood came up short against Stratford in their previous meeting back in September of 2017, falling 14-10. Can Kingwood avenge their defeat or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
